Title:   Lamp
Category:   Lamps
Description:   Intact.
Very shallow lamp on flat bottom. Sharply convex sides. Broad flat top. Narrow raised band around filling hole. Large nozzle encroaching but little on top.
Red to black glaze inside, for the band around the filling hole, for a broad band around the top, and for the nozzle; otherwise, with remains of dilute glaze wash.
Type V (first variety) of Corinth collection, type 20 of Agora collection.
Cf. Agora IV, pp. 43-44, nos. 149-155, pls. 5, 34.
Corinth IV, ii, pp. 42-43, nos. 91-99, pl. II.
